The parent company of Google, Alphabet, has withdrawn its support for the Makani Power-generating project. The news has been confirmed by the CEO of Makani Enterprises, MR. Fort Felker through a blog that he posted on 18 February 2020. It is the first project of Alphabet that has been called off by them, and several figures have criticized Sundar Pichai for signing off this venture. Larry Page and Sergey Brin started the project X after acquiring Makani in 2013. Project X was an innovative venture by Makani to make wind energy in a more affordable and accessible way.

Makani was started in 2006 by Saul Griffith, Don Montague, and Corwin Hardham with an initiative of producing the cheapest wind energy. The company had also proven this fact and yet received desirable funding from Google in 2013. The project was named as Google X at that time and alter to X in 2019 after Makani officially assign to Alphabet.

Makani was once an independent company that has been supported by Shell several times. After being abandoned by Alphabet, Makani has decided to go along with Shell again. Makani CEO has drawn the statement through his blog in which he stated; the subsequent decision of Alphabet will not determine the future of Makani Technology. He added that Makani is no longer an acquisition of Alphabet, and we are assigning Shell to develop and look upon the technology attribute of Makani.
